Aims to determine the perceived extent of implementation of the school reading intervention programs in relation to the schools' National Achievement Test (NAT) during the S.Y. 2012-2013, results of which serve as basis in designing a school reading program to improve teachers' implementation of the different reading intervention programs; concludes that the higher the extent of the school reading intervention program by the teachers, the better their schools' performance in the NAT.
